What is a serum and why do I need one in my routine?

A serum is a light or gel lotion that contains a high concentration of performance ingredients. Are you wanting to achieve next-level results in your routine? This is the gamechanger. Applied underneath a moisturiser or treatment mask this skincare product delivers powerful ingredients directly into the skin. Serums are made up of smaller molecules that can penetrate deeply into the skin and deliver a very high concentrate of active ingredients. They are a great tool for targeting specific skincare concerns and driving high-powered results.

How often should I use my serum?

This depends on the serum. As everyone’s skin is different, ingredients will have varying effects on the skin. For example, Some ingredients may be too active for some people’s skin. If you haven’t used a serum before you would want to start with an ingredient that targets your main skin concern. It is recommended to visit a skin expert for a personalised skin analysis.
